Committee on Vocational Education
Records, 1918-1919

Record Group Number: RG 16.3.087

2 folders

Historical Sketch:
The Committee on Vocational Education was established to investigate how well the Mount Holyoke curriculum prepares its graduates for their future work. The Committee was appointed by the Board of Trustees and was composed of a variety of faculty members.

Description of Records:
The records contain reports issued periodically by the Committee. The reports contain information relating to students education at Mount Holyoke under the curriculum, at that time with their employment experiences after graduation.
